An excellent techie with strong experience in OS Engineering, Kernel Development, ProLiant Server, Networking * Linux debugging skill * Very well versed with debugging and rot cause analysis * Linux ...
An excellent techie with strong experience in OS Engineering, Kernel Development, ProLiant Server, Networking * Linux debugging skill * Very well versed with debugging and rot cause analysis * Linux ...
Linus Admin/Developer
Houston, TX · On-site
An excellent techie with strong experience in OS Engineering, Kernel Development, ProLiant Server, Networking * Linux debugging skill * Very well versed with debugging and rot cause analysis * Linux ...
Linus Admin/Developer
Houston, TX · On-site
An excellent techie with strong experience in OS Engineering, Kernel Development, ProLiant Server, Networking * Linux debugging skill * Very well versed with debugging and rot cause analysis * Linux ...
System Level Software Engineer - Driver Development - 2784 -OJO
Houston, TX · On-site
$165K - $195K/yr
Windows Kernel and/or Driver Programming experience (XP, Vista, Windows 7, or Windows 8) or current Linux Kernel Driver programming experience. 6-8+ years C, C+ programming experience. 6-8+ years of ...
System Level Software Engineer - Driver Development - 2784 -OJO
Houston, TX · On-site
$165K - $195K/yr
Windows Kernel and/or Driver Programming experience (XP, Vista, Windows 7, or Windows 8) or current Linux Kernel Driver programming experience. 6-8+ years C, C+ programming experience. 6-8+ years of ...
This position requires a true senior engineer who is deeply technical, highly autonomous, and ... Troubleshoot complex OS issues (kernel, boot, networking, PAM, systemd, SSH). * Manage system ...
This position requires a true senior engineer who is deeply technical, highly autonomous, and ... Troubleshoot complex OS issues (kernel, boot, networking, PAM, systemd, SSH). * Manage system ...
This position requires a true senior engineer who is deeply technical, highly autonomous, and ... Troubleshoot complex OS issues (kernel, boot, networking, PAM, systemd, SSH). * Manage system ...
This position requires a true senior engineer who is deeply technical, highly autonomous, and ... Troubleshoot complex OS issues (kernel, boot, networking, PAM, systemd, SSH). * Manage system ...
Systems Software Expert
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Systems Software Expert
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Systems Software Expert
Spring, TX · On-site
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Systems Software Expert
Spring, TX · On-site
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Systems Software Expert
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Systems Software Expert
$154K - $182K/yr
Knowledge of Linux kernel developers- device driver development with focus on networking devices * Knowledge of InfiniBand and programming with RDMA Verbs * Background in embedded system architecture 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Virtualization
Spring, TX · Hybrid
$50 - $68.50/hr
Cloud Developer III - Virtualization This role has been designed as 'Hybrid' with an expectation 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· On-site
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Cloud Developer III - Storage/Networking
Spring, TX · On-site
$50 - $68.50/hr
Cloud Developer III - Storage/Networking This role has been designed as 'Hybrid' with an ... You have experience developing for and debugging in Linux kernel/OS environments. * You have ...
Houston - SAP BASIS Engineer
Houston, TX · On-site
Operating system knowledge of Linux or AIX * Experience in at least one cloud platform - AWS or ... Apply Kernel upgrade/DB Patch/Support Packs upgrades across landscape systems using a structured ...
Houston - SAP BASIS Engineer
Houston, TX · On-site
Operating system knowledge of Linux or AIX * Experience in at least one cloud platform - AWS or ... Apply Kernel upgrade/DB Patch/Support Packs upgrades across landscape systems using a structured ...
Linux operating system - understanding of OS, cpu/memory/system architecture * User space coding (no kernel mode), on prem device * Multithreaded programming - use of mutexes, locks etc * Algorithms ...
Linux operating system - understanding of OS, cpu/memory/system architecture * User space coding (no kernel mode), on prem device * Multithreaded programming - use of mutexes, locks etc * Algorithms ...
Linux operating system - understanding of OS, cpu/memory/system architecture * User space coding (no kernel mode), on prem device * Multithreaded programming - use of mutexes, locks etc * Algorithms ...
Linux operating system - understanding of OS, cpu/memory/system architecture * User space coding (no kernel mode), on prem device * Multithreaded programming - use of mutexes, locks etc * Algorithms ...
Senior Software Engineer
$117K - $154K/yr
Axiom Space is the leading provider of human spaceflight services and developer of human-rated ... Linux on embedded systems preferably system on a chip including kernel and driver development.
Senior Software Engineer
$117K - $154K/yr
Axiom Space is the leading provider of human spaceflight services and developer of human-rated ... Linux on embedded systems preferably system on a chip including kernel and driver development.
Senior System Administrator
Houston, TX · On-site
$82K - $111K/yr
... Linux distributions (RHEL, Ubuntu Server). Advanced mastery of performance tuning, kernel ... version 1.0 3.4. DevOps, Automation & Tooling • Configuration Management: Mastery of ...
Senior System Administrator
Houston, TX · On-site
$82K - $111K/yr
... Linux distributions (RHEL, Ubuntu Server). Advanced mastery of performance tuning, kernel ... version 1.0 3.4. DevOps, Automation & Tooling • Configuration Management: Mastery of ...
Linux Kernel Developer information
See Houston, TX salary details
$96.4K - $102.9K
4% of jobs
$102.9K - $109.4K
4% of jobs
$109.4K - $115.9K
4% of jobs
$115.9K - $122.4K
1% of jobs
$122.4K - $128.9K
9% of jobs
$130.1K is the 25th percentile. Wages below this are outliers.
$128.9K - $135.5K
11% of jobs
$135.5K - $142K
12% of jobs
The median wage is $144.2K / yr.
$142K - $148.5K
14% of jobs
$148.5K - $155K
15% of jobs
$155.6K is the 75th percentile. Wages above this are outliers.
$155K - $161.5K
14% of jobs
$161.5K - $168K
13% of jobs
$96.4K
$142.3K
$168K
How much do linux kernel developer jobs pay per year?
What are some common challenges Linux Kernel Developers face when integrating new features or patches?
What Does a Linux Kernel Developer Do?
A Linux kernel developer uses computer code to create a program that functions as the core of a computer operating system. Your duties can include creating kernels for open-source operating systems for desktop computers, laptops, phones, and tablets. You can also develop programs for embedded systems for routers, smart devices, or automated machinery. Linux uses C programming languages, so you often write code in C and C++. In addition to your coding responsibilities, you also test and debug your programs. Your employer may ask you to develop applications, drivers, and other tools to use with your kernel.
What does a Linux Kernel Developer do?
What are the key skills and qualifications needed to thrive as a Linux Kernel Developer, and why are they important?
What is the difference between Linux Kernel Developer vs Linux Device Driver Developer?
| Aspect | Linux Kernel Developer | Linux Device Driver Developer |
|---|---|---|
| Required Credentials | Proficiency in C, Linux kernel development experience, often a degree in Computer Science or related field | Similar credentials, with focus on device-specific programming and hardware knowledge |
| Work Environment | Developing and maintaining core kernel components, often in a Linux environment | Writing and debugging drivers for specific hardware devices within Linux |
| Employer & Industry Usage | Tech companies, open-source projects, hardware manufacturers | Hardware manufacturers, embedded systems, specialized device companies |
While both roles require strong C programming skills and Linux knowledge, Linux Kernel Developers focus on core kernel development, whereas Linux Device Driver Developers specialize in creating drivers for hardware components. The roles often overlap but differ in scope and focus within the Linux ecosystem.

Contractor
Posted 3 days ago
Job description
Rate:- $25 per hr Max
Job Description
Who are we looking for?
A mid-level System Engineer - Linux Developer to manage a critical project for one of our biggest client in enterprise domain. The Individual should be passionate about technology, experienced in testing and managing cutting edge technology applications.
Technical Skills:
- An excellent techie with strong experience in OS Engineering, Kernel Development, ProLiant Server, Networking
- Linux debugging skill
- Very well versed with debugging and rot cause analysis
- Linux OS knowledge
- Linux and microcontroller expert
- Coding experience for micro controllers
- Work experience with Microchip
- QA knowledge
- Great communication skill and able to work little or no supervision.
- Knowledge of HPE Servers and other HPE Firmware, Enterprise Applications
Process Skills:
- Capable of analyzing requirements and test software, firmware as per project defined process
- Understand the Priority, Urgency and Managing Customer Expectations
- Ability to duplicate, debug, resolve customer reported issues in a very high paced environment.
Behavioral Skills:
- Resolve technical issues of projects and Explore alternate designs
- Participates as a team member and fosters teamwork by inter-group coordination within the modules of the project.
- Effectively collaborates and communicates with the stakeholders and ensure client satisfaction
- Train and coach members of project groups to ensure effective knowledge management activity.
- Somebody who has at least 4+ years of work experience in Linux Kernel Development.
- Education qualification: B.Tech, BE, BCA, MCA, M. Tech or equivalent technical degree from a reputed college
All your information will be kept confidential according to EEO guidelines.